Bartender Jobs in Maine
A Bartender plays a crucial role in the hospitality service industry. They are responsible for preparing and serving al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ages to customers, interacting with guests, taking orders, and serving snacks and bar food. Bartenders also accept payments, keep the bar well-stocked and clean, and ensure that all standards and legal obligations are met. In addition, they are often the first point of contact for customers and play a key role in establishing a welcoming atmosphere.
Bartenders require a set of specific skills and certifications. In most areas, they need to have a valid bartender's license or certification in responsible alcohol service. Strong customer service skills, excellent communication and interpersonal skills, the ability to work under pressure, and knowledge of drink mixing and garnishing are crucial. Before becoming a Bartender, an individual might start with roles such as a Barback, responsible for assisting the Bartender, a Server in a restaurant or a Host/Hostess. These positions provide valuable customer service experience and knowledge of the food and beverage industry.
